Output e6ed59760abfaba2a77459bce1e50b7b70c642f3fc60e3371cf2ce0685360482:25

value
32102715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6018873d41d7304fd5c19961c5a26a06d0febeaa OP_EQUAL
address
3AT8BDNcmdcMTdHYGChWXYcmQ4LxexZZkE
transaction
e6ed59760abfaba2a77459bce1e50b7b70c642f3fc60e3371cf2ce0685360482
spent
true